Output 143cd53a625d25cef02cf219fea5eb74a9f131a5daf647f1cf8bbe5ab17fff1f:1

value
2749992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eeb1ad2adc0f940212fc42b69da5b3c94f60f04 OP_EQUAL
address
3EihX9ekvJVf9nfLL4x5mqzNkN45fdfnnP
transaction
143cd53a625d25cef02cf219fea5eb74a9f131a5daf647f1cf8bbe5ab17fff1f
confirmations
304607
spent
true